It was described as the “Rebirth of an icon”. Indeed, Jaeger-LeCoultre’s Polaris Memovox watch features the special alarm function extracted from the 1968 Memovox Polaris watch, and was hence introduced today at SIHH 2018. In a place where expertise and innovation are a must, the House really lived up to its legacy by unveiling a novelty that sees the past, but doubles it in a modernized way. In fact, the timepiece reveals an updated and modernized movement, 60 years after its creation.

Polaris Memovox
- 42mm stainless steel case
- Black sun-rayed dial with grained and opaline finishes
- Automatic mechanical movement, Jaeger-LeCoultre Caliber 956
- Hours/minutes/seconds, alarm, date
- Power reserve 44 hours
- Water resistance 200m
- New rubber strap and new folding buckle
- Limited edition of 1,000 pieces
